In the Compare It! compare options, there is a “Ignore comments” options, which can be defined for each profile.
But there is a problem that this option is expected to be reset to false if we select the "Ignore nothing" mode when viewing file during compare.
This is not the case.
It seems to use the “Default profile” settings even in this case, instead.
There is a risk to mistakenly loose date here.
